Local and state government disagree on best ways to tackle major increases in property offences and violence in central Australian town

Federal and local authorities have held crisis talks over the escalating wave of crime and violence across Alice Springs.

Tensions have been escalating in the central Australian town after an increase in property offences, assaults, and joyriding in stolen cars. NT police statistics show reported property offences jumped by almost 60% over the past 12 months, while assaults have increased by 38% and domestic violence assaults by 48%.
